On the Flooded Highway
This is one of the poems I've been working on regarding the bad weather and flooding from early December 2007.
Macramé
Thick threads of headlights
in the north- and southbound lanes
can’t stop the river pulling loose—
a million knots give way,
dirt, branches, leaves
and water all over the place.
